Output e91203077915684f6ba8f1ecb42c6df2170bc1eec5337a8db03a05d8b90a2cb5:1080

value
2845081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b89315cf971560e20e1051ac5e0f5861063315f OP_EQUAL
address
38aQxFnAyg3zcxiL1oQrap7UVUQcR2cNgv
transaction
e91203077915684f6ba8f1ecb42c6df2170bc1eec5337a8db03a05d8b90a2cb5
spent
true